The difference between a superficial patch and a proper concrete repair can significantly impact the longevity and structural integrity of your property. A patch might address an immediate cosmetic issue, but a true repair often involves addressing the underlying cause of the damage, such as sub-base instability or water infiltration, before applying a more robust solution. This meticulous approach is crucial for projects ranging from sidewalk rejuvenation to foundation reinforcement. A concrete and paver driveway project in Montgomery typically involves laying a concrete base for structural support and then incorporating paver sections for aesthetic appeal. The process includes site preparation, excavation, and grading, followed by the installation of the concrete foundation and formwork for the paver areas. Once the concrete cures, the pavers are meticulously laid in the chosen pattern, with sand swept into the joints to stabilize them. Proper drainage considerations are crucial throughout the installation.
The cost to replace a concrete driveway in Montgomery depends on several variables. These include the square footage of the driveway, the thickness of the new concrete pour, and the extent of sub-base preparation required, such as demolition and removal of the old surface. Decorative finishes, colored concrete, or stamped patterns will also add to the overall expense. A professional assessment of your specific site conditions is necessary for an accurate quote.
Yes, stampcrete patios can certainly be installed in Montgomery. This decorative concrete technique involves impressing patterns and textures onto the surface of freshly poured concrete, mimicking materials like natural stone or brick. The process requires skilled application to achieve clean, defined designs. Proper sealing and curing are essential to ensure the durability and aesthetic longevity of the stamped patio in the local climate.
Foundation repair contractor services in Montgomery address issues like settling, cracking, or bowing of a building's foundation. This can involve various techniques, including underpinning with piers, crack injection using epoxies or polyurethanes, or waterproofing solutions. A thorough inspection is necessary to diagnose the specific problem and determine the most effective repair strategy, ensuring the long-term stability of the structure.

Concrete and paver driveways in Montgomery offer a blend of durability and aesthetic appeal. The concrete base provides a strong, stable foundation, while the pavers allow for intricate patterns, color choices, and easier repair of individual sections if damaged. This combination can enhance curb appeal and offer a more customizable look compared to a solid concrete surface, while still providing the robust performance needed for vehicular traffic.
